House Rules: There are specific endgame related issues that apply to larger Dom3 games that I have come to dread. There will be a simple Big Game Mod (v1.1) that will be used for this game that will tweak a few end-game aspects.

These changes are not up for debate in this thread.

Big Game Mod Changes:
Arcane Nexus will cost 300 Astral Pearls to cast
Clam of Pearls will require a path 2 (instead of 1) in Nature Magic (Water will stay the same). This will increase the cost to forge.
Fever Fetishes will require a path 2 (instead of 1) in Fire Magic (Nature will stay the same). This will increase the cost to forge.
(New in v1.1)Blood Stone will require a path 3 (instead of 2) in Earth Magic (Blood will stay the same). This will increase the cost to forge.

thejeff
March 6th, 2008, 09:59 PM
It seemed to work out as I'd expected.

The Crone moved 2 provinces and now has a move of 1: The movement orders and destinations are determined by the 3.14 client.

The Mother I recruited had the random: The order had been given, but the actual unit got created on the server.

No cost changes so I don't know how that would play out.

For those who are interested, the Mother and Daughter each get a 100% AN random instead of one of their previous Nature paths. So no more total paths, but a bit more flexibility. Still a very limited nation magically.
